- Large cluster of threads about NDI devices not appearing or intermittent visibility; especially problematic across VLANs, Wi‑Fi, and VPN setups.
- Causes: multicast being blocked on switches, Windows Firewall, antivirus software, network segmentation, and outdated NDI SDK/driver versions.
- Workarounds: enable NDI Discovery Server, configure static IPs, use Unicast if supported, ensure all devices on same subnet or enable multicast/IGMP snooping appropriately.
